From mboxrd@z Thu Jan 1 00:00:00 1970 Return-Path: Received: from ffbox0-bg.mplayerhq.hu (ffbox0-bg.ffmpeg.org [79.124.17.100]) by master.gitmailbox.com (Postfix) with ESMTP id 509DC49D26 for ; Fri, 8 Mar 2024 15:37:35 +0000 (UTC) Received: from [127.0.1.1] (localhost [127.0.0.1]) by ffbox0-bg.mplayerhq.hu (Postfix) with ESMTP id BD2DF68CB95; Fri, 8 Mar 2024 17:37:33 +0200 (EET) Received: from mail-lj1-f174.google.com (mail-lj1-f174.google.com [209.85.208.174]) by ffbox0-bg.mplayerhq.hu (Postfix) with ESMTPS id D568B68CB95 for ; Fri, 8 Mar 2024 17:37:27 +0200 (EET) Received: by mail-lj1-f174.google.com with SMTP id 38308e7fff4ca-2d2505352e6so30152401fa.3 for ; Fri, 08 Mar 2024 07:37:27 -0800 (PST)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=gmail.com; s=20230601; t=1709912247; x=1710517047; darn=ffmpeg.org; h=to:subject:message-id:date:from:in-reply-to:references:mime-version :from:to:cc:subject:date:message-id:reply-to; bh=ipbHFGa+ny/e/EbIqx9anRULdVGcYe+RSTHl0x+FFAc=; b=iBP2nfVIN8dqAYmmJZMcHxZDAWG6zN5VMjpDuGthjxVpAczRPQkKDxlQfXRwL3w44K opA9BcYGnPNWNYPDJBP09tR3lYYqM+YtipSJeHiB3sPdnC1Jc5G6ugK2YiTWNYdKSx5Q 9/r0Dhfy/Rw2MZc7G6bZwg0PuaS6hAoD36+umnlKE/KSPvQ7HHHaZS7OHh2h4z61Pvcs /oGegwUk12eS1/Yny95ARdXI1sXm/cxwTDy1XQwuGTaKBVrj7lYgnz0psd987wwNbNOV 157vAiefTYOIJAZlBOroSG9wM2T2ehZrbhwBX+xHCBqczmoMuvVO1SPEfcKxtcC2I9hE WMXg== X-Google-D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=1e100.net; s=20230601; t=1709912247; x=1710517047; h=to:subject:message-id:date:from:in-reply-to:references:mime-version :x-gm-message-state:from:to:cc:subject:date:message-id:reply-to; bh=ipbHFGa+ny/e/EbIqx9anRULdVGcYe+RSTHl0x+FFAc=; b=Fo3UDe3HtgkpEhv6cn2ssBi7JnndBmt29vfVHA92A77jdDg1kVz9pQYdhynfnyH6Uv d+ucn9ljNENjwOSdxKUw7LXo+Ffn5Nxwy1ywxIVfUBgSBxOLSvlW26XCc0afB1YuZiiZ k4n5gu1Tl+5s2QyU4Yzb6GreuI3YQvZgC2PWcujLf1lvgkoLqFMSfqizpivZrs5je865 U+qtHom0cKn/6bnm65kXWVSkaWqtVeTxrCxzSaOs4iSr60ffhbDkytHHgR706e6nMiTT 6zGr1cE9Ngz7ZYg2k4eYc8wM/LkWOvsSGSO1co5oDlownbSibmbmCGO2QzFf9Qlh8ZtD +LDg== X-Gm-Message-State: AOJu0YzFP2djkgeWk2Q4sV1KuBAHro3iZC98ODKB9bgb7ulBTPDjoi0+ ium3H3MBRENA8Zt3QWT8yDyFCVUyCDSzF40m0FvreG8KY+N4vgya9uGp9KpOyKFB7qH9tKXbM/5 NKlmioelbhyRF9TRmaN1OH11fEkkv1ChP X-Google-Smtp-Source: AGHT+IEPzHq+GA45dXFljDeBCP9YWGo4XTpq0ddvepPlRXdeaW/6mc1je1Qr875mC9O1zKHOm8J+6GBXl2ALva6c8DY= X-Received: by 2002:a2e:87d4:0:b0:2d2:c8c2:5cb3 with SMTP id v20-20020a2e87d4000000b002d2c8c25cb3mr3639674ljj.33.1709912246580; Fri, 08 Mar 2024 07:37:26 -0800 (PST) MIME-Version: 1.0 References: <20240308082749.20028-1-anton@khirnov.net> <20240308082749.20028-2-anton@khirnov.net> <170989285192.7287.17016576053815588581@lain.khirnov.net> <170989331707.7287.60934458751012067@lain.khirnov.net> <170989589460.662.6679884374613626910@lain.khirnov.net> In-Reply-To: From: Vittorio Giovara Date: Fri, 8 Mar 2024 16:37:15 +0100 Message-ID: To: FFmpeg development discussions and patches X-Content-Filtered-By: Mailman/MimeDel 2.1.29 Subject: Re: [FFmpeg-devel] [PATCH 2/3] lavc: replace ff_thread_get_buffer() with ff_get_buffer() X-BeenThere: ffmpeg-devel@ffmpeg.org X-Mailman-Version: 2.1.29 Precedence: list List-Id: FFmpeg development discussions and patches List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Reply-To: FFmpeg development discussions and patches Content-Type: text/plain; charset="utf-8" Content-Transfer-Encoding: base64 Errors-To: ffmpeg-devel-bounces@ffmpeg.org Sender: "ffmpeg-devel" Archived-At: List-Archive: List-Post: T24gRnJpLCBNYXIgOCwgMjAyNCBhdCA0OjM04oCvUE0gU2VhbiBNY0dvdmVybiA8Z3NlYW5tY2dA Z21haWwuY29tPiB3cm90ZToKCj4gT24gRnJpLCBNYXIgOCwgMjAyNCwgMTA6MzEgUGF1bCBCIE1h aG9sIDxvbmVtZGFAZ21haWwuY29tPiB3cm90ZToKPgo+ID4gT24gRnJpLCBNYXIgOCwgMjAyNCBh dCA0OjIx4oCvUE0gVml0dG9yaW8gR2lvdmFyYSA8Cj4gPiB2aXR0b3Jpby5naW92YXJhQGdtYWls LmNvbT4KPiA+IHdyb3RlOgo+ID4KPiA+ID4gT24gRnJpLCBNYXIgOCwgMjAyNCBhdCA0OjEw4oCv UE0gU2VhbiBNY0dvdmVybiA8Z3NlYW5tY2dAZ21haWwuY29tPgo+IHdyb3RlOgo+ID4gPgo+ID4g PiA+IE9uIEZyaSwgTWFyIDgsIDIwMjQsIDA4OjIwIE5pY29sYXMgR2VvcmdlIDxnZW9yZ2VAbnN1 cC5vcmc+IHdyb3RlOgo+ID4gPiA+Cj4gPiA+ID4gPiBBbmRyZWFzIFJoZWluaGFyZHQgKDEyMDI0 LTAzLTA4KToKPiA+ID4gPiA+ID4gV2hhdCBtYWludGVuYW5jZSBjb3N0IGFuZCBjb21wbGV4aXR5 IGFyZSB5b3UgcmVmZXJyaW5nIHRvPyBJCj4gPiBjaGVja2VkCj4gPiA+ID4gYW5kCj4gPiA+ID4g PiA+IGNvdWxkIG5vdCBmaW5kIGEgc2luZ2xlIGNvbW1pdCB3aGVyZSBvbmUgaGFkIHRvIGZpeCBh bgo+ID4gPiBmZl9nZXRfYnVmZmVyKCkKPiA+ID4gPiA+ID4gdG8gZmZfdGhyZWFkX2dldF9idWZm ZXIoKSBiZWNhdXNlIGl0IGhhcyBiZWVuIGZvcmdvdHRlbiB3aGVuIHRoZQo+ID4gPiA+IGRlY29k ZXIKPiA+ID4gPiA+ID4gaGFzIGJlZW4gZGVjbGFyZWQgdG8gc3VwcG9ydCBmcmFtZSB0aHJlYWRp bmcuCj4gPiA+ID4gPgo+ID4gPiA+ID4gV2VsY29tZSB0byB0aGUgbmV3IEZGbXBlZywgd2hlcmUg YWJzb2x1dGUgY29uc2lzdGVuY3ksIGkuZS4KPiBjYXRlcmluZwo+ID4gPiBmb3IKPiA+ID4gPiA+ IGh5cG90aGV0aWNhbCBtZWRpb2NyZSBjb250cmlidXRvcnMsIGlzIG1vcmUgaW1wb3J0YW50IHRo YW4gZWFzeQo+ID4gPiA+ID4gb3B0aW1pemF0aW9ucyBhbmQgbmV3IGFwcHJvYWNoZXMuCj4gPiA+ ID4gPgo+ID4gPiA+ID4gQW5kIGlmIHlvdSBkbyBub3QgbGlrZSBpdCwg4oCcc2h1dCB1cCwgSSdt IG9uIHRoZSBUQyBhbmQgSSB3b24ndAo+ID4gcmVjdXNl4oCdLgo+ID4gPiA+ID4KPiA+ID4gPiA+ IEFuZCBpZiB5b3UgZG8gbm90IGxpa2UgdGhhdCwg4oCcc2h1dCB1cCwgSSdtIG9uIHRoZSBDQyB0 b2/igJ0uCj4gPiA+ID4gPgo+ID4gPiA+ID4gUmVnYXJkcywKPiA+ID4gPiA+Cj4gPiA+ID4gPiAt LQo+ID4gPiA+ID4gICBOaWNvbGFzIEdlb3JnZQo+ID4gPiA+ID4gX19fX19fX19fX19fX19fX19f X19fX19fX19fX19fX19fX19fX19fX19fX19fX18KPiA+ID4gPiA+IGZmbXBlZy1kZXZlbCBtYWls aW5nIGxpc3QKPiA+ID4gPiA+IGZmbXBlZy1kZXZlbEBmZm1wZWcub3JnCj4gPiA+ID4gPiBodHRw czovL2ZmbXBlZy5vcmcvbWFpbG1hbi9saXN0aW5mby9mZm1wZWctZGV2ZWwKPiA+ID4gPiA+Cj4g PiA+ID4gPiBUbyB1bnN1YnNjcmliZSwgdmlzaXQgbGluayBhYm92ZSwgb3IgZW1haWwKPiA+ID4g PiA+IGZmbXBlZy1kZXZlbC1yZXF1ZXN0QGZmbXBlZy5vcmcgd2l0aCBzdWJqZWN0ICJ1bnN1YnNj cmliZSIuCj4gPiA+ID4gPgo+ID4gPiA+Cj4gPiA+ID4gRXZlcnlib2R5IGNhbiB3ZSAqcGxlYXNl KiBrZWVwIHRoZSByZXNwb25zZXMgY2l2aWwvcHJvZmVzc2lvbmFsIG9uCj4gdGhlCj4gPiA+IE1M Lgo+ID4gPiA+Cj4gPiA+Cj4gPiA+IEknZCBqdXN0IGJlIGhhcHB5IHdpdGggIm9uLXRvcGljIiBi dXQgaXQgc2VlbXMgbGlrZSBwZW9wbGUgd2l0aCBhZ2VuZGFzCj4gPiA+IGxpa2UgdG8gcHJvamVj dCBvbiB1bnJlbGF0ZWQgdGhyZWFkcy4KPiA+ID4KPiA+Cj4gPiBMaWJBViBhY3Rpb25zIHNwZWFr IG1vcmUgdGhhbiB3b3JkcyBvbmNlIGFnYWluLgo+ID4KPiA+Cj4gPiA+IC0tCj4gPiA+IFZpdHRv cmlvCj4gPiA+IF9f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19f Cj4gPiA+IGZmbXBlZy1kZXZlbCBtYWlsaW5nIGxpc3QKPiA+ID4gZmZtcGVnLWRldmVsQGZmbXBl Zy5vcmcKPiA+ID4gaHR0cHM6Ly9mZm1wZWcub3JnL21haWxtYW4vbGlzdGluZm8vZmZtcGVnLWRl dmVsCj4gPiA+Cj4gPiA+IFRvIHVuc3Vic2NyaWJlLCB2aXNpdCBsaW5rIGFib3ZlLCBvciBlbWFp bAo+ID4gPiBmZm1wZWctZGV2ZWwtcmVxdWVzdEBmZm1wZWcub3JnIHdpdGggc3ViamVjdCAidW5z dWJzY3JpYmUiLgo+ID4gPgo+ID4gX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19f X19fX19fX19fX18KPiA+IGZmbXBlZy1kZXZlbCBtYWlsaW5nIGxpc3QKPiA+IGZmbXBlZy1kZXZl bEBmZm1wZWcub3JnCj4gPiBodHRwczovL2ZmbXBlZy5vcmcvbWFpbG1hbi9saXN0aW5mby9mZm1w ZWctZGV2ZWwKPiA+Cj4gPiBUbyB1bnN1YnNjcmliZSwgdmlzaXQgbGluayBhYm92ZSwgb3IgZW1h aWwKPiA+IGZmbXBlZy1kZXZlbC1yZXF1ZXN0QGZmbXBlZy5vcmcgd2l0aCBzdWJqZWN0ICJ1bnN1 YnNjcmliZSIuCj4gPgo+Cj4gSXQgaXMgcmVhbGx5IG1lYW4tc3Bpcml0ZWQgdG8gbWFrZSBzdWNo IGNvbW1lbnRzIGFib3V0IGEgcHJvamVjdCB0aGF0IGlzIG5vCj4gbG9uZ2VyIGluIG9wZXJhdGlv bi4gQ2FuJ3Qgd2UgbG9vayBmb3J3YXJkIGluc3RlYWQgb2YgYmVoaW5kIHVzPwo+CgpDb3VsZCB5 b3UgZ3V5cyBsb29rIGZvcndhcmQgaW4gYSBzZXBhcmF0ZSB0aHJlYWQ/IPCfmY8KLS0gClZpdHRv cmlvCl9f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fCmZmbXBl Zy1kZXZlbCBtYWlsaW5nIGxpc3QKZmZtcGVnLWRldmVsQGZmbXBlZy5vcmcKaHR0cHM6Ly9mZm1w ZWcub3JnL21haWxtYW4vbGlzdGluZm8vZmZtcGVnLWRldmVsCgpUbyB1bnN1YnNjcmliZSwgdmlz aXQgbGluayBhYm92ZSwgb3IgZW1haWwKZmZtcGVnLWRldmVsLXJlcXVlc3RAZmZtcGVnLm9yZyB3 aXRoIHN1YmplY3QgInVuc3Vic2NyaWJlIi4K